    The Enchanting Beauty of the Alur Village Girl

    December 13, 2024 Uncategorized 4 Mins Read
    Facebook Twitter Pinterest LinkedIn Tumblr Email WhatsApp
    Share
    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est Email

    Nestled in the vibrant heart of Zombo, where the sun bathes the landscape in a warm golden glow and the air is filled with the delightful aroma of freshly uprooted ground nuts, lives a village maiden whose beauty has woven itself into the fabric of local folklore. Her name is Giramia, and she is far more than an ordinary girl; she personifies elegance, charisma, and a magnetic charm that has enchanted every man in the village, and perhaps even a few wandering spirits.

    Giramia’s skin shines like polished calabash beneath the blazing midday sun, a deep, lustrous tone that seems to absorb all light, radiating pure beauty. The villagers often remark that she is so stunning that even the village goats pause in their grazing to admire her as she strolls by, her hips moving in harmony with the gentle cadence of a traditional agwara dance. It is said that her laughter can bring a smile to even the most cantankerous elder, and her smile? Well, it is whispered that it could awaken the dead from their slumber.

    It is her eyes that truly captivate the men of the village. They resemble shimmering pools of mischief and enigma. When she looks deep into your soul—yes, your very essence—it feels as though she can uncover all your secrets, your aspirations, and even those cringe-worthy moments from your primary school. Strangely, you find yourself feeling both vulnerable and utterly spellbound at the same time.

    The village men have begun spinning elaborate stories about Giramia’s enchanting eyes. Some believe they contain the wisdom of ages, while others assert, they can forecast the weather. One creative soul claims that if you gaze into them long enough, you might just discover the fate of all those missing socks after laundry day.

    Naturally, Giramia’s allure has attracted suitors from near and far. Villagers are now vying for her affection with increasingly absurd acts of bravery. One man crafted a crown from okudhu katoli – cactus plants and proclaimed himself the “King of Giramia’s Heart.” Another tried to woo her with a song he wrote on his mother’s old adungu, only to forget the lyrics halfway through.

    The village is abuzz with excitement as men devise intricate plans to win her affection. Some have resorted to presenting her with gifts like oruru – freshly picked wild strawberry or katoku – beautifully crafted basket, hoping to capture her interest. Yet, they remain oblivious to the fact that Giramia values genuine acts of kindness over extravagant displays; perhaps they should consider lending a hand in fetching water from the well instead.

    In the midst of this frenzy, Giramia remains blissfully unaware of the influence she holds over these smitten villagers. Her days are spent nurturing her family’s garden in Oturugang and sharing laughter with her girlfriends beneath the sprawling branches of an ancient mango tree. Her beauty transcends mere appearance; it emanates from her very essence, creating a warmth that draws everyone in.

    As night descends upon the village and stars shimmer like scattered jewels in the sky, one truth stands out: Giramia is not just a stunning Alur girl; she is an inspiration for poets and dreamers alike. While men may compete for her attention with their antics, it is her vibrant spirit that truly captivates them—a poignant reminder that true beauty is found not only in looks but in kindness, joy, and an unwavering love for life.

    Here’s to Giramia—the enchanting village girl with dark skin, whose stunning beauty captivates and charms everyone around her. May she journey through life enveloped in admiration, joy, and maybe a sprinkle of delightful chaos from those who aspire to win her affection!
